Travis Hunter underwent surgery to repair the LCL in his right knee on Tuesday.
The surgery showed no additional damage beyond the LCL.
Hunter is expected to return to full football activities within six months.
Hunter played significant time on both offense and defense for the Jaguars this season.
He recorded 28 catches for 298 yards and a touchdown, and 15 tackles with three pass breakups on defense.
Why this matters: Hunter was a key player for the Jaguars on both sides of the ball, and his absence will be a significant loss for the team as they push for a playoff spot. His versatility and playmaking ability made him a valuable asset.
Travis Hunter Jr., the Jaguars' highly touted rookie, suffered a non-contact knee injury during practice on October 30th. After initial evaluation and placement on injured reserve, the decision was made for Hunter to undergo surgery to repair the LCL in his right knee. The procedure, performed in Dallas by Dr. Dan Cooper and Jaguars team physician, Dr. Kevin Kaplan, was successful, with no further damage detected beyond the LCL.
Hunter’s absence leaves a void in both the Jaguars’ offense and defense. He played 67% of the team's offensive snaps and 36% of the defensive snaps in the games he appeared in, showcasing his unique two-way abilities. His 28 receptions for 298 yards and a touchdown, along with his defensive contributions, highlight his impact on the team.
The Jaguars (5-4) are now tasked with adjusting their strategy as they prepare to face the Los Angeles Chargers. The team will need to find ways to compensate for Hunter’s production and versatility.
